Good Morning Robert, I use Visio, first setup an ODBC connection to the database (MyODBC) then run the database Wizard and if fetches all the keys and coulmns and builds a big drawing. Good Luck, Ken - Original Message - From: Robert Goeres [EMAIL PROTECTED] To: [EMAIL PROTECTED]
